Several of our largest clients have been personal friends of mine for fifteen years. How do we systematically transfer these personal relationships to our sales team on a multi-year runway so a buyer does not write down our customer retention rate?
If your largest clients only do business with you, your business has high customer concentration risk and is highly vulnerable. You must systematically transfer these relationships on a three-to-five-year runway. Start by restructuring your Accountability Chart to create a dedicated account management seat. Introduce your team members as the primary points of contact for all daily operations, billing questions, and project delivery. Gradually stop attending routine client meetings. If a client calls your cell phone, route the request through your team and have them deliver the solution. Use your weekly Level 10 Meeting to monitor client satisfaction metrics on your scorecard. When buyers look at your customer concentration during due diligence, they must see that the accounts are serviced entirely by your team. This proves the customer goodwill belongs to the company brand, not to you personally, which protects your valuation.
